Abstract

Realising a fine dental impression is an essential task to obtain a correct diagnostic cast. Non-contact optical methods achieve high precision measurements and maximise patient’s comfort. This paper aims to implement an advanced multiview optical technique for reconstructing three-dimensional dental elements. The main novelty of the proposed approach is to integrate fringe projection and image correlation techniques, thus increasing accuracy of dental reconstruction. This study represents a step towards the standardisation of a non-contact protocol for dental measurements.
